Midjourney用双冒号(::)控制关键词的权重
1、双冒号(::)有什么用
简单来说,双冒号可以用来分割关键词和控制权重。
1.1、双冒号(::)可以分割关键词
在midjourney使用多个关键词,用“空格”来分割关键词时,midjourney会把关键词作为前后关联的短语去生成图片。
当我们用“::”去分割关键词的话,midjourney则会把这些关键词更好的融合起来表达。
示例:输入butter fly,会生成完整的蝴蝶,而butter:: fly,就有会把黄油(butter)和苍蝇(fly)融合起来
但如果仅仅作为分割关键词的用途,个人觉得,这个功能没有真实应用的场景,所以大家这里仅作为了解即可。
1.2、双冒号(::)可以控制关键词的权重
双冒号(::)除了可以分割关键词之外,更重要的是,还可以通过在双冒号(::)后输入数值,达到控制每个关键词在画面中权重的目的,而这,才是双冒号(::)真正的价值所在。
上面说了,分割关键词没什么实际用途,所以这篇文章,将主要给大家介绍下权重的用法。
2、双冒号(::)如何输入权重
双冒号(::)控制权重,只需关键词后输入双冒号+数值即可。
示例:hot::2 dog(仅标红为空格部分,双冒号之间无空格)
左图当仅使用双冒号把“hot dog”分割成“hot”和“dog”之后。如果只用双冒号,不输入数值时,此时权重默认为1,说明“热”和“狗”一样重要。
而当在双冒号后输入了输入数值2,如右图,说明“热”的权重是“狗”的2倍,此时生成的图,明显比左图生成的狗更“热”,甚至都着火了
3、举个实用的例子——用双冒号(::)控制生成的关键词权重
通过权重控制关键词的不同权重,逐渐调试并生成需要的图片。
当我想生成一张可以直接应用的,男人在厨房做饭的插画图,我用下方的关键词
首次生成的图片如下
图片并没有处理好人物半身照,于是我需要增强半身照
此时,生成的图1和图2,都是比较符合我预期的图了。
注:midjourney的随机性还是非常大的,需要多次尝试